
Politico has named Ben Reininga
as vice president audio & video, effective June 24, and Haley Thomas as head of content-audio & video, starting on July 8.
The investment in these hires reflects “a top priority
for our organization: to expand the ways we reach and engage our audience,” says the announcement by Goli Sheikholeslami, chief executive officer and John Harris, global editor in chief of
Politico.
Reininga will report to Jonathan Greenberger and Thomas will report to Reininga.
Previously, Reininga was global head of news at Snapchat, where he spent five
years.
Thomas arrives from CNN, where she served as a founding member of the audio team and was instrumental in advancing CNN’s audio strategy.
The announcement continues
that “Ben and Haley will work with teams across North America and Europe and lead our ambitious plans to diversify our distribution strategy and redefine how audiences experience Politico
journalism."
